The RealReal has an employee rating of 2.9 out of 5 stars, based on 1,598 company reviews on Glassdoor which indicates that most employees have an average working experience there. The The RealReal employee rating is in line with the average (within 1 standard deviation) for employers within the Retail & Wholesale industry (3.5 stars).

Nice benefits (at the time of employment, they've since changed). A few perks such as discounts, treats and catered meals. There are a couple very good, dedicated managers here. Company has a bright future but many massive changes need to happen. Get to know the people in HR, they are very nice.

Cons

Horrible Work/Life balance, lowballing the industry's standard pay. Company would rather throw more bodies at work instead of compensate employees for all their hard work. Its nice to have more hands to help but those hands also take away work hours. Employees need max work hours because hourly pay is insufficient. Basically the company wouldn't invest in employees and hard workers are not valued. Managers are not qualified to manage. Unprofessionalism such as guilt trips and 'pity parties' from the veterans if the company. If you bring an issue to the higher ups they will use their own past experiences and compare them to your present experience (so you're suppose to feel sorry for them and feel bad that you brought up an issue). Bad at handling toxic environment. Issue came up, nothing was done about it (gossiper roams free). Theres not much room to grow once you have the steps down so don't expect to learn many new skills. If you are a warehouse worker looking to learn new skills in completely different, better paying jobs. You should jump at this opportunity ($$). With that said, more than a few people from outside the department were brought in to do work that they were not trained or qualified for, creating problems for other departments.
